Despite problems with equiping them, I hadn't any trouble with the squad 'kill' button (the squad would happily charge off and smash a buzzardect) till a titan showed up; when asked to kill it the dwarves promptly ran to their barracks and refused to come out. This was extremely funny at the time but getting a little annoying; the only way I can aget them to fight things now is the old system of stationing them next to a monster. Does anyone know what might be cousing this, equipment issues>?

It's probably equipment issues.  I had a whole squad except one dwarf decide that they'd really rather hang out in the barracks than go kill the goblins attacking the dwarven caravan.  They'd sometimes go outside the door, then turn around and come back in again.  I wasn't checking their equipment and it seems some had picked up more than one weapon, two shields, etc and perhaps they were chasing each other to take the items the others were wearing.
I had to reload and try again with a move order, this was more successful but I still lost the caravan.  I'm going to try disbanding them all, dumping their equipment and trying again with a fresh uniform, now that I know how they work.
